What's Happening?
Entropy Technologies LP has acquired a new stake in Kohl's Corporation, purchasing 62,660 shares valued at approximately $808,000. This investment comes as Kohl's faces a challenging market environment, with analysts providing mixed ratings on the company's
stock. According to MarketBeat, Kohl's has an average rating of 'Reduce' and a price target of $15.31. The company's recent financial performance showed a slight improvement, with earnings per share exceeding expectations by $0.05, despite a year-over-year revenue decline of 1.7%. Kohl's continues to operate approximately 1,100 stores across 49 states, offering a range of products from apparel to home goods.
